SEASON TEAM G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I BB SO SB CS AVG OBP SLG OPS
2003 Bos 128 448 79 129 39 2 31 101 58 83 0 0 .288 .369 .592 .961
2004 Bos 150 582 94 175 47 3 41 139 75 133 0 0 .301 .380 .603 .983
2005 Bos 159 601 119 180 40 1 47 148 102 124 1 0 .300 .397 .604 1.001
2006 Bos 151 558 115 160 29 2 54 137 119 117 1 0 .287 .413 .636 1.049
2007 Bos 149 549 116 182 52 1 35 117 111 103 3 1 .332 .445 .621 1.066
and him being 32 at the start of the 2008 season, you saw this [projected] season coming:
SPLITS G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I BB SO SB CS AVG OBP SLG OPS
Projected 161 636 97 113 16 0 16 121 89 129 0 0 .177 .286 .278 .564
I would have said no way. But even with his horrific start, he is projected to have 121 RBIs; more than the 117 RBIs he had last year.
